The Tradition of Cast Iron Cookware


Cast iron cookware has a rich history that dates back centuries. Its ability to withstand high temperatures, provide even heating, and retain heat for long periods makes it a favorite for many cooking enthusiasts. From frying, sautéing, and baking to serving, cast iron skillets are versatile tools that add a unique flavor to food. The natural non-stick surface, achieved through proper seasoning, also enhances the cooking experience.

German Factories A Commitment to Quality


German factories that specialize in cast iron skillets allocate significant resources to ensure that their products meet the highest standards of quality. The manufacturing process begins with selecting high-grade raw materials, primarily cast iron, which is renowned for its durability and excellent heat retention qualities. This focus on quality materials sets the stage for producing skillets that can withstand years of rigorous use.


Once the raw materials are sourced, German manufacturers employ advanced casting techniques that have been honed over decades. Traditionally, the sand casting method is widely used, where molten iron is poured into molds made from fine sand. This technique helps create skillets with a sturdy, even surface that facilitates efficient cooking. Some factories have also embraced modern technology while preserving traditional craftsmanship, allowing for precise designs that appeal to a broad audience.

Exceptional Craftsmanship


What truly sets German cast iron skillets apart is the exceptional craftsmanship that goes into each piece. Skilled artisans oversee the production process, ensuring that every skillet meets the brand's exacting standards. From shaping and polishing to seasoning and packaging, each step is carried out with precision and care.


The seasoning process is particularly important for creating the characteristic non-stick surface of cast iron skillets. Many German manufacturers use vegetable oils to season their skillets, a method that not only enhances the skillet's cooking performance but also gives it a robust, natural finish. After seasoning, the skillets are tested for quality, and only those that pass rigorous checks make it to market.
